All POV's used by volunteer firefighters and/or rescue personnel must meet the following requirements in order to be classified as a public safety vehicle: Must have the State of Ohio minimum insurance limits for bodily injury and property damage. The Internal Revenue Code provides an exception under IRC 3121 (b) (6) (C) from social security and Medicare tax for a worker “serving on a temporary basis in case of fire, storm, snow, earthquake, flood, or other similar emergency. An employee who is a volunteer firefighter and who may be absent from or late to work in order to respond to an emergency in the course of performing the duties of a volunteer firefighter shall make a reasonable effort to notify the employer that the employee may be absent or late. The Volunteer Fire Assistance (VFA) Grant program is a 50/50 cost share grant program administered through the Ohio Division of Forestry.
